AEW and THQ Nordic have shared new screenshots from the upcoming ‘Fight Forever’ console video game.

The new shots feature the updated models of a number of AEW stars, including Kenny Omega, Jon Moxley and Hangman Page.

Fans were also given their first look at the game’s character HUDS, as well as several new modes.

The following features have been announced for the upcoming release:

  • Match Types
    • Single Matches
    • Tag-Team
    • 3-Way
    • 4-Way
    • Ladder Matches
    • Casino Battle Royale
    • Falls Count Anywhere
    • Unsanctioned Lights-Out (allows use of weapons)
    • Exploding Barbed Wire Death Matches
  • Career Mode
  • Wide Range of Customization Modes
    • Custom Wrestlers (attire and appearance)
    • Custom Move-Sets
    • Custom Entrances
    • Custom Teams
    • Custom Arenas
    • Online Multiplayer
  • Leaderboards
